Grainger Editorial Staff. Laboratory beakers are vessels in which liquid is placed so it can be stirred, mixed or heated. They come in a variety of shapes, sizes and materials depending on the application, and can be reusable or disposable.

The graduated cylinder is the most basic piece of volumetric glassware in the lab. The word volumetric ( volume measure) is used to describe lab ware that can be used to measure liquid volumes more precisely than a beaker or flask. Web5 nov. 2024 · Beakers are used for routine measuring and mixing in the lab. They are used to measure volumes to within 10% accuracy. Most beakers are made from borosilicate glass, though other materials may be used. WebA beaker is a cylindrical glass or plastic vessel used for holding liquids.
